Output e2cfbcaaeed92d68d18fcfdfe70752da6cfede66d75dbd7cfbdcb000962efe56:0

value
43794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dbd65942be2820d66467bf650d708de0ba1e634 OP_EQUAL
address
35rsDhKQk1Pg87kKweaQtTV5W625t6r4Z1
transaction
e2cfbcaaeed92d68d18fcfdfe70752da6cfede66d75dbd7cfbdcb000962efe56
confirmations
239630
spent
true